Subject: DR drill notes for weekly eng sync — billing worker blue-green

Team, next Tuesday's disaster-recovery drill at Korvath Labs will exercise the blue-green deploy path for the Ledgerline billing worker. We will cut traffic from the blue pool to green, simulate a region loss in Drellport, then fail back. Please verify your dashboards reflect the swap within five minutes. If the automated cutover stalls, the standby operator must unlock the recovery console manually. The console will prompt for the passphrase shown below.

strongbox words: alddor-rusius-belox-gorys-holius-oliix-ralmir-lamvan-briius-fraion-zormir-novwyn-zormir-holmir

## Handover: Pinforge dependency pinning

Handing Pinforge over to on-call for the week. Our pinning policy: every service pins exact versions, and the weekly unpin job opens bump proposals that must pass the full suite before merge. If a CVE advisory arrives, you may fast-track a bump, but record it in the exceptions log. The resolver behaves differently per environment, so double-check which you are touching. The production resolver currently runs with these configuration values.

service settings:
PRAIX_LOG_LEVEL=error
PRAIX_METRICS_HOST=metrics.praix.qorvelcorp.corp
PRAIX_POOL_SIZE=16

# Nightly search reindex client — read before poking at this.
#
# This sets up the connection to Lanternfish, our internal search
# cluster, for the 02:00 reindex job. If you're on-call and the job
# wedges, the usual culprit is a stale auth token, not the cluster
# itself. Restart the job once before escalating; it's idempotent
# and safe to rerun. Rate limits are generous at night, so don't
# worry about hammering it. The client authenticates with the key
# directly below:

service key, fawip-bajef: kto11_Qt5wZK9vdNC

Ticket: Archive cold storage buckets (Heronvault tier-3). Buckets untouched for 18 months will be moved to glacier-class storage and delisted from the console. Restore requests will take up to 48 hours afterward. No data is deleted. Future maintainers: see the archive manifest in the runbook repo. This action requires sign-off from the storage owner.

named custodian: Oliath Ralax